Usain Bolt will be in action today at the World Athletics Championships in Beijing. The world record holder will be lining up for the semi-finals of the 200-metres. The Jamaican will be aiming to win gold in this event for a fourth time in a row. To do that, he’ll need to overcome rival Justin Gatlin who’ll be looking to win back the title he first took in Helsinki 10 years ago.
